Lothar Matthäus cautions VfB Stuttgart and Borussia Dortmund that they may struggle to retain players Deniz Undav and Felix Nmecha, respectively, if the duo continue their strong performances at the World Cup. Both players recently signed long-term contracts, but Matthäus suggests significant interest from other clubs could arise. He highlights the potential for nine-figure transfer fees, recalling Borussia Dortmund's loss of Jude Bellingham to Real Madrid for over €100 million after the last World Cup. Matthäus underlines the coaches' intentions to build successful teams, noting that the loss of key players would complicate those plans.
